Three No-Mess Science Connections
- Lava Flow Simulation: Use warm (not hot) corn syrup dyed with food-grade red coloring (McCormick Neon Red, 3 drops per ¼ cup) poured slowly over a tilted tray lined with aluminum foil. Discuss viscosity and flow patterns—no heat, no splatter.
- Ash Cloud Observation: Fill a clear 1-liter glass jar ¾ full with water. Add 1 tsp cornstarch and stir gently. Shine a flashlight through the side—observe light scattering (Rayleigh scattering principle). Relate to real ash clouds blocking sunlight.
- Crater Formation:Drop marbles (1.5 cm diameter, silicone-coated for safety) from three heights (15 cm, 30 cm, 45 cm) onto flour-covered cardboard. Measure resulting crater diameters with a ruler marked in millimeters—introduce measurement and comparison.

Common Pitfalls & How to Avoid Them
Even well-intentioned adults accidentally undermine learning. Avoid these evidence-based missteps: First, never say “color inside the lines”—this discourages creative expression and increases anxiety. Instead, say “Let’s see how many colors you can use for the lava!” (promotes experimentation). Second, don’t correct color choices (“Lava isn’t green!”). Magma is orange-red; cooled lava rock is black/gray—but imaginative interpretation builds confidence. Third, skip rewards-based praise (“Good job!”). Use descriptive feedback: “I see you used three different shades of red—that shows careful mixing!” (per Carol Dweck’s growth mindset research, 2022).
